The cheapest way to get from Luton to Dunblane is to bus which costs £40 - £80 and takes 9h 23m.
The fastest way to get from Luton to Dunblane is to fly and train which takes 2h 41m and costs £45 - £160.
No, there is no direct bus from Luton to Dunblane station. However, there are services departing from Luton DART Parkway and arriving at Dunblane Police Station via Shudehill Interchange and Buchanan Bus Stn.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 9h 23m.
No, there is no direct train from Luton to Dunblane. However, there are services departing from Luton and arriving at Dunblane via King's Cross and Edinburgh Waverley.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 6h 26m.
The distance between Luton and Dunblane is 347 miles. The road distance is 392.2 miles.
The best way to get from Luton to Dunblane without a car is to train via Edinburgh which takes 6h 26m and costs £150 - £260.
It takes approximately 2h 41m to get from Luton to Dunblane, including transfers.
Luton to Dunblane bus services, operated by FlixBus, depart from Luton DART Parkway station.
Luton to Dunblane train services, operated by Thameslink, depart from Luton station.
The best way to get from Luton to Dunblane is to train via Edinburgh which takes 6h 26m and costs £150 - £260.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s £40 - £80 and takes 9h 23m.
